#7791c6 color RGB value is (119,145,198). #7791c6 color name is Custom Color color.

#7791c6 hex color red value is 119, green value is 145 and the blue value of its RGB is 198.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#7791c6 hue: 0.61, saturation: 0.41 and the lightness value of 7791c6 is 0.62.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#7791c6 color hex is 0.40, 0.27, 0.00, 0.22. Web safe color of #7791c6 is #6699cc. Color #7791c6 contains mainly BLUE color.

About #7791C6 Custom Color

#7791C6 (Custom Color) is a blue-based color with RGB values of 119, 145, 198. This color belongs to the blue color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#7791c6,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#7791c6 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#7791c6), RGB (rgb(119, 145, 198)), HSL (hsl(220, 41%, 62%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#6699cc,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
